Output dc32da90bbefb68ed784b69918601a36ac4205e4e4396ab0cfad67cab6b2d458:0

value
9409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d030f9e7351c04eb23193b2a13dc75cdee50f7 OP_EQUAL
address
3KBEPZyimCUrr6MeTnvqEpRuREkUTb2Uwr
transaction
dc32da90bbefb68ed784b69918601a36ac4205e4e4396ab0cfad67cab6b2d458
confirmations
88272
spent
true